How much do remote garden world j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ote garden world in the United States is $21.42,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.31 and $24.28 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ges faced by team members working remotely for a garden-focused company, and how can they be addressed?

Working remotely for a garden-focused company often means collaborating with colleagues and clients across different locations and time zones, which can pose challenges in communication and coordination. Team members may also miss hands-on access to gardens or products, making it important to rely on detailed visuals, virtual tours, and regular updates. To address these challenges, many companies invest in strong digital communication tools, schedule regular video meetings, and encourage proactive sharing of photos and project progress. Building a supportive virtual team culture helps ensure everyone stays connected and engaged, despite working remotely.

Primary Care | Internal Medicine | 100% Remote
StartDate: ASAP Pay Rate: $250000.00 - $310000.00

Join an innovative virtual primary care model that combines advanced AI technology with the trusted clinical standards of some of the country's premier health systems, including Mayo Clinic, Mass General Brigham, Cedars-Sinai, Hackensack Meridian Health, and Hartford HealthCare.


This is more than a traditional telehealth position. As part of an integrated health system, you'll provide ongoing, relationship-based primary care to established patient panels while maintaining continuity of care through seamless access to specialists, referrals, and a fully integrated Epic electronic medical record.
